Gary Bailey, 86, of Winterset, formerly of Creston and Afton area, died Wednesday, April 2, 2025, in Mt. Ayr at the Clearview Home. A Celebration of Life Service will be at 1:00 p.m. Sunday, April 6, 2025, at the Powers Funeral Home in Afton. Pastor Jodi Rushing will officiate the service. The burial will be at Greenlawn Cemetery in Afton. Flag presentation will be by Theodore J. Martens, Creston VFW Post #1797. Open visitation with family receiving friends will be 2:00- 5:00 p.m., Saturday, April 5, 2025, at Powers Funeral Home in Afton with Masonic Services beginning at 4:30 p.m. Memorials are kindly suggested to the Clearview Home & Hospice or Shriner's Hospital for Children. Gary Ross Bailey, son of Jesse "Doc" Ross Bailey and Maymie Pearl (Petersohn) Bailey, was born on March 17, 1939, in rural Union County in Thayer. Gary graduated from Thayer High school with the class of 1957. After graduation, Gary was united in marriage to Linda Stalker on June 5, 1960, in Creston, Iowa. The two settled in Creston where Gary worked at the Coke Plant actively driving a delivery route. In 1962, Gary served his country as a part of the United States Army until his honorable discharge in 1964.
After leaving the military they settled in Afton, working for the U.P.S. in Creston. He would then work for Creston Feed & Grain, Springfield Plastics. Gary and Linda later divorced. While working for B&K Commercial Agriculture Gary actively helped with the building of grain bins and elevators.
On April 14, 1984, Gary was united in marriage to Connie (Callison) Utsler in Kellerton, Iowa. The two moved to Mt. Ayr where he owned and operated a car wash. While in Mt. Ayr, Gary also ran a lawn care service and was a Walker Lawn Mower dealership for 20 years. As part of his lawn care business Gary took care of Rose Hill Cemetery in Mt Ayr. Following Gary's retirement in 2003 he moved to rural Winterset.
Gary was a member of the Methodist Church, a 50-year member of the Crest City Masonic Lodge #522. He spent many years as a member of the Za Ga Zig Shrine and the Creston B.P.O. Elks Lodge #605. Gary enjoyed playing softball and pool and was also particularly passionate about the game of golf and was a member of the development group who established the Lake Shore Golf and Country Club where he was a member for many years. He also was a member of the Mt. Ayr and Winterset Country Clubs.
Gary is survived by his two daughters, Lisa (husband Bill) Gregerson of Indianola and Stacy Christiansen of Des Moines; a brother, Bill (wife Marge) Bailey of Creston, a sister, Phyllis Clark of Afton; two sisters-in-law, Delores Bailey of Chapin, and Shirley Bailey of Creston; two grandchildren, Bailey (Kohl) Dusenbery of Indianola and Brandon (Lindsey) Gregerson of Urbandale; two great-grandchildren, Peyton and Kaycee Dusenbery; and his furry companion, Bella.
Preceding him in death is his parents, wife, Connie Bailey in 2021, his two sisters, Betty (husband Leland) Eckhardt Ruby (husband Ronald) Cornelison; his two brothers, Robert, and Richard Bailey; brother-in-law, Donald Clark; and four fur babies: Sammie, Mindy, Jody, and Blondie.
